Fading occurs on the edges of a photo
Verify that the photo paper is not curled. If the photo paper is curled, place the paper
in a plastic bag and gently bend it the opposite direction of the curl until the paper lies
flat. If the problem persists, then use photo paper that is not curled.

PictBridge problems
Images in a connected digital camera do not print
There are several reasons why images in a connected digital camera do not print:
●
The digital camera is not PictBridge-compatible.
●
The digital camera is not in PictBridge mode.
